Investment thesis
Jumpstart Health Investors focuses exclusively on investing in the future of healthcare, positioning itself as a co-pilot for healthcare innovation and change. Its platform provides a range of opportunities tailored to different investor types and risk appetites, spanning early-stage venture to direct co-investments. It operates several distinct funds: Jumpstart Foundry, a pre-seed index fund for individuals seeking accessible private health investments with low minimums; Jumpstart Capital, a fund designed for successful entrepreneurs seeking co-investment opportunities alongside an investment club; and Jumpstart Nova, an institutional, strategic healthcare venture seed fund.

- What stage does Jumpstart Health Investors invest at?
- Jumpstart Health Investors invests at the Pre-Seed, Seed, Series A, Series B, Series C, Growth, Late Stage stages.
- What sectors does Jumpstart Health Investors focus on?
- Jumpstart Health Investors focuses on Biotech, Digital Health, Healthtech, Medical Devices, Wellness & Fitness.
- Where is Jumpstart Health Investors located?
- Jumpstart Health Investors is headquartered in Nashville, US.
